(616) 816-8536 is a Medicare Robocall
Be cautious.
- Listen
- Transcript Hello. Good morning. My name is Jessica Adams. The reason for my call is that the updated plan for Medicare has just been released. Do you have a minute to check what additional benefits you can qualify for? I am sorry. I didn't get that. Do you have a minute to discuss your Medicare benefits? Well, what we do here is help you get additional Medicare benefits, like flexcard prescription coverage, and food card, at absolutely no cost, for which we need to confirm your eligibility. Do you have part a and part b of Medicare? Mm hmm. Okay, I get it. But we are here to provide free information about the open enrollment 2024 and help you compare your benefits among 27 leading insurance companies. Our licensed agent is on the line, and I would strongly suggest you review your options with him. But before that, I would just like to confirm your age. Can I ask how old you are? Mm hmm. Okay, so I still have to confirm your age for your qualification. Can you please tell me how old you are? I'm sorry, I didn't get that. Can you please tell me how old you are? Okay, well, I apologize. I will make sure to put your number in the do not call list. Take care and goodbye.
